Which of the following would be essential to implement to prevent late postpartum hemorrhage?
 
  A) Administering broad-spectrum antibiotics
  B) Inspecting the placenta after delivery for intactness
  C) Manually removing the placenta at delivery
  D) Applying pressure to the umbilical cord to remove the placenta

Answer to Question 1

B
Response:
After the placenta is expelled, a thorough inspection is necessary to confirm its intactness because tears or fragments left inside may indicate an accessory lobe or placenta accreta. These can lead to profuse hemorrhage because the uterus is unable to contract fully. Administering antibiotics would be appropriate for preventing infection, not postpartum hemorrhage. Manual removal of the placenta or excessive traction on the umbilical cord can lead to uterine inversion, which in turn would result in hemorrhage.

Answer to Question 2

C
Response:
In some cases of pneumothorax, administration of 100 oxygen hastens the reabsorption of air, but it is generally used for only a few hours. Children with severe pneumonia require supplemental oxygen to overcome an obstruction, while children with bronchiolitis and chronic lung disorders need oxygen to improve gas exchange.
